What is an equation for the line perpendicular to y = 3x – 1 that passes through (-9, -2)?

Respuesta :

firered21
firered21 firered21
  • 17-10-2021

Answer:

y = -1/3 x - 5

Step-by-step explanation:

Remember that perpendicular lines will have an opposite slope. Notice how the slope of the original line goes from 3/1 to -1/3.
